Inspect Regularly
To ensure the longevity and performance of your Auburn home's roof, regularly inspect it for any signs of damage or wear and tear. By conducting regular inspections, you can identify and address potential issues before they become major problems.
Start by visually examining the roof for missing or damaged shingles, cracks in the flashing, or any signs of sagging. Pay close attention to areas around chimneys, vents, and skylights, as they're prone to leaks. Additionally, check for any debris buildup, such as leaves or branches, as they can trap moisture and cause rot.
Use binoculars to inspect the roof from the ground, but if safe, walk on the roof to get a closer look. Remember, regular inspections are key to maintaining the integrity of your Auburn home's roof.
Clean Debris and Gutters
- Start by regularly cleaning debris and gutters to maintain the condition of your Auburn home's roof. This simple task can prevent a multitude of problems.
When debris, such as leaves, branches, and dirt, accumulates on your roof, it can trap moisture and cause rotting. Additionally, clogged gutters can lead to water overflow, which can damage your roof and foundation.
To clean your roof, use a broom or leaf blower to remove any loose debris. Be cautious and avoid walking on the roof to prevent potential damage.
For gutter cleaning, remove any leaves or debris by hand or use a garden hose to flush them out.
Address Leaks Promptly
When addressing leaks promptly, homeowners in Auburn should be vigilant in identifying and repairing any signs of water damage on their roofs. Neglecting leaks can lead to significant structural damage and costly repairs. Here are five important steps to address leaks promptly and prevent further damage:
- Regularly inspect your roof for any signs of leaks, such as water stains, mold growth, or missing shingles.
- Act quickly at the first sign of a leak by locating the source and applying temporary patches or sealants.
- Hire a professional roofing contractor to conduct a thorough inspection and make necessary repairs.
- Maintain proper attic ventilation to prevent moisture buildup, which can contribute to roof leaks.
- Keep gutters and downspouts clear of debris to ensure proper water drainage and prevent water from seeping into your home.
Schedule Professional Inspections
Regular professional inspections are essential for maintaining the integrity and longevity of your roof. By scheduling these inspections, you can identify any potential issues before they turn into major problems.
A professional roofing inspector has the expertise to thoroughly examine your roof and identify any signs of damage or wear. They'll check for loose or missing shingles, signs of water damage, and any potential structural issues.
These inspections not only ensure that your roof remains in good condition but also provide you with peace of mind knowing that you have taken the necessary steps to protect your home. Additionally, professional inspections are often required by insurance companies, so by scheduling them regularly, you can ensure that your policy remains valid.
